Private lending refers to loans provided by non-bank, private lenders — typically secured against real property. Unlike bank loans, private lenders focus primarily on the value of the security property and the borrower's exit strategy, rather than income, employment, or credit history. This makes private lending accessible to a wide range of borrowers who don't meet standard bank criteria.

Private loans are faster, more flexible, and assessed primarily on property equity rather than income or credit. They are typically shorter-term (1–24 months), interest-only, and carry higher interest rates than bank loans. They are designed for situations where speed, flexibility, or access (for non-standard borrowers) is more important than achieving the lowest possible rate.
Private loan rates start from 7.99% p.a. Rates depend on the security property type and location, the loan-to-value ratio (LVR), the loan purpose and term, and the borrower's credit and exit strategy. Rates are higher than bank loans to reflect the greater flexibility and speed of approval offered by private lenders.
Up to 70–75% LVR for residential metro first mortgage security. Second mortgages are generally available up to 70% combined LVR. Higher LVR may be possible in some circumstances — for example, where there is a clear and defined exit such as a confirmed property sale.
